亚洲在线久爱草,狠狠天天香蕉网,天天搞日日干久草,伊人亚洲日本欧美

為了賬號安全,請及時綁定郵箱和手機立即綁定

HTML5小游戲---愛心魚(下)

難度中級
時長 3小時27分
學習人數
綜合評分9.80
87人評價 查看評價
9.9 內容實用
9.9 簡潔易懂
9.6 邏輯清晰
@蔬菜果醬
看看你momTail 的src吧
讀取不到這個圖片的寬度 。
我按照大魚吃果實的動畫一樣,結果小魚一直是true,然后不斷執行
老師辛苦了,有你在我們更有信心
可以規定每次吃黃色果實加100,吃藍色果實加500呀。。。

最新回答 / jcn
我是在 collision.js 類里判斷fruitType[i] 的時候增加 else ,將 data.double =1; ?
魚為什么會眨眼睛,我表示不理解啊~~~~~~~~~~~~~~~~~~~~
https://shenshiman.github.io/happyfish_game/index.html 盡管有很多問題 最終還是解決了,跟著老師打,可以學到很多
透明度不成功的同學可以試下 ctx1.globalAlpha=alpha 這個API 完美解決
老師講講程序結構的思路啊,在我看來還是蠻亂的,有幾處個人感覺結構不合理。
跟著巧了好幾天終于學完了,收獲非常多,老師的游戲設計的非常細節有美感,太棒了!
游戲少女心瞬間爆棚了
感覺老師這個游戲考慮了很多小細節,非常有美感
Failed to execute 'drawImage' on 'CanvasRenderingContext2D': The HTMLImageElement provided is in the 'broken' state."報錯重新下載圖片資源就行了,因為缺少圖片,所以繪制不出來

最新回答 / supjtr
for(var i=0; i<this.num; i++){ if(this.alive[i]){ //draw this.r[i] += deltaTime*0.04; if(this.r[i]>50){ this.alive[i] = false; continue; } var alpha = 1 - this.r[i]/50; ctx1.beginPath(); ctx1.arc(this.x[i], this.y[i], this.r[i]...

最新回答 / 丟lld
這段代碼,沒有問題,但是不能解決問題,你回頭再跟老師的仔細比對一下
課程須知
1、對html、css基礎知識已經掌握。 2、對JavaScript的基礎知識掌握,如數組、類、對象。 3、學習本課程之前您最好已經學習完成《HTML5小游戲---愛心魚(上)》
老師告訴你能學到什么?
1、html5 canvas制作游戲理念 2、html5 canvas 繪圖API 3、游戲中的碰撞檢測 4、認識幾個數學函數 5、物體池概念 6、序列幀動畫的控制

微信掃碼,參與3人拼團

微信客服

購課補貼
聯系客服咨詢優惠詳情

幫助反饋 APP下載

慕課網APP
您的移動學習伙伴

公眾號

掃描二維碼
關注慕課網微信公眾號

友情提示:

您好,此課程屬于遷移課程,您已購買該課程,無需重復購買,感謝您對慕課網的支持!

本次提問將花費2個積分

你的積分不足,無法發表

為什么扣積分?

本次提問將花費2個積分

繼續發表請點擊 "確定"

為什么扣積分?

舉報

0/150
提交
取消